The price of a 40 ft shipping container can vary considerably based on numerous factors. Comprehending these can help prospective buyers make notified decisions.
FactorDescriptionConditionNew, utilized, or reconditioned containers will have various rates.TypeGeneral-purpose, high cube, refrigerated, and so on, affect pricing.PlacePrices can vary by region due to shipping costs and availability.Market DemandVariations in the market can result in rates modifications.ModificationAdditional modifications (like insulation or windows) increase cost.ProviderVarious suppliers might have differing pricing models.Condition
The condition of the shipping container is among the most significant aspects affecting its rate. New containers will be more pricey, normally varying from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 8,000, while utilized containers can be discovered for as low as ₤ 2,000 to ₤ 5,000, depending on their condition and age.
Type
There are numerous types of 40 ft shipping containers, each suited to various purposes. High cube containers, which provide an additional foot in height, are often more costly than basic containers. Cooled containers, created for keeping specific temperatures, can likewise be significantly more costly.
Area
Geographic location plays a crucial role in figuring out prices. For example, containers might be cheaper in seaside locations with shipping ports compared to inland areas, where transportation expenses increase the final rate.
Market Demand
The shipping container market is affected by supply and need characteristics. In times of high demand, prices might rise, while during sluggish durations, discount rates might be readily available.
Personalization
Numerous purchasers choose to personalize their shipping containers for particular usages, such as converting them into offices or homes. Modification can considerably increase the base cost of the container.
Supplier
Various suppliers and producers can have varying prices strategies. Online sellers, regional suppliers, and auction websites might provide different prices structures based on their functional costs and target markets.
2. Average Sale Prices
To assist potential buyers comprehend typical cost ranges, the following table lays out average costs based on container condition and type.
Container TypeConditionTypical Price RangeStandard 40 ft ContainerNew₤ 5,000 - ₤ 8,000Standard 40 Ft Shipping Container Sale Price ft ContainerUtilized₤ 2,000 - ₤ 5,000High Cube 40 ft ContainerNew₤ 6,000 - ₤ 9,000High Cube 40 ft ContainerUtilized₤ 3,000 - ₤ 6,000Cooled 40 ft ContainerNew₤ 10,000 - ₤ 25,000Cooled 40 ft ContainerUtilized₤ 5,000 - ₤ 15,0003. Different Types of 40 Ft Shipping Containers
Shipping containers can be found in various types, each serving distinct purposes. Comprehending these can assist purchasers in making the Best 40 Ft Shipping Container To Buy option based upon their needs.
Requirement Containers: Basic containers used for general storage and transportation.High Cube Containers: Offer extra height for more storage area, suitable for large items.Refrigerated Containers: Designed for transporting perishable items, featuring insulation and refrigeration systems.Open Top Containers: Suitable for oversized cargo, permitting for loading from the top.Flat Rack Containers: Ideal for big machinery or goods that can be packed from the sides.4.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How do I figure out the condition of an utilized shipping container?
A1: Inspect the container for rust, structural stability, and functionality of doors and seals. It's likewise recommended to ask for a study or inspection report from the seller.
Q2: What is the typical life expectancy of a shipping container?
A2: With appropriate upkeep, a shipping container can last for up to 25 years.
Q3: Can I finance a shipping container purchase?
A3: Yes, some providers offer funding alternatives, or you can consider individual loans for larger purchases.
Q4: Are there options for tailoring a shipping container?
A4: Absolutely! Lots of providers provide customization services, consisting of insulation, electrical work, and more.
Q5: What are the common usages for a 40 ft shipping container?
A5: Common uses consist of storage, portable offices, pop-up stores, homes, and even gym areas.
